About the role

  • Executing the regional legal strategy to support Solvay’s growth in Asia Pacific, considering broader industry shifts and public sentiment.
  • Leading a small, multi-jurisdictional team, fostering an environment where different perspectives drive innovative legal solutions.
  • Acting as a trusted advisor to the regional leadership, delivering a broad range of legal services helping to guide Solvay’s industrial and commercial footprint in the region.
  • Assessing complex risks in a shifting regulatory landscape, particularly regarding environmental stewardship, trade, and corporate integrity.
  • Collaborating with global teams to protect our intellectual property and navigate complex partnerships in the region.

Requirements

  • A Master’s degree in Law or equivalent professional practice is required.
  • A minimum of 12 years of legal experience, with a significant focus on the Asia Pacific region and able to deliver a broad range of legal advice and documents across commercial, corporate, M&A and Intellectual Property matters (patents, licensing agreements, etc.).
  • A proven track record with at least 5 years of experience of building and leading regional legal departments in an international environment.
  • Authorized to practice law in China.
Benefits
  • Solvay Cares program: minimum of 16 weeks of parenting leave for all employees and package with healthcare, disability and life insurance coverage.
  • Prioritization of well-being: work-life balance promotion, flexible approach to work part-time or hybrid work arrangements (depending on the type of job), employee assistance program with access to physical and psychological support.
  • Professional development: prioritization of internal talents for career progression, access to a training platform, opportunities to join Employee Resource Groups (ERG) for experience sharing and mentorship and free language courses.
